No rear lights 900 1995

There is no relay for the rear lights, there is however a bulb out sensor or detector, it is NOT a relay as commonly thought. It's location is shown at the link I gave you as are all of the fuses for the various rear lights. The bulb out sensor is not likely to cause outage of both brake and running lights at the same time. You may find on your 95 that the bulb out sensor is located in the left trunk area.

Are all rear running lights and brake lights left and right including the 3rd brake light really out as you stated? That would be most strange and unusual as they are on separate fuses and separately wired. What about license plate lights and back up lights. On some years of the 960/S series all rear lighting shared a common ground, not sure about your year.

No rear lights 900 1995

I am not familiar with the 960's. However, in the 740/940 series cars if you have no brake lights (including the third) and the fuse and switch are functional it is usually the bulb out sensor relay. Pulling the round red cover off and examining under a strong light with a magnifying glass will usually allow you to see a bad solder joint. Simply resolder the broken joint and you will usually have brake lights again.

With the added absense of tail lights this advice may in fact be useless and I am sorry I can not provide any more help. Aren't the fuses and their location identified in the owner's manual or on the back of the ashtray as in the earlier cars?

No rear lights 900 1994

I am not familiar with the 940's. If they are like the 740's, and many times they are, the bulb out relay would be under the ashtry in front of the center console.

The relay is bright red and round. A broken solder joint may be evident under strong light with the aid of a magnifying glass.
